Word: Pong
Speech Type: Noun
Etymology:
early 20th century: of unknown origin
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
pɒŋ
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a strong, unpleasant smell
Short Definition:strong, unpleasant smell
Examples:- corked wine has a powerful pong
Word: Pong
Speech Type: Verb
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
pɒŋ
Dialects: British English
Definition:
smell strongly and unpleasantly
Short Definition:smell strongly
Examples:- the place just pongs of dirty clothes
